Watched a little bit of hope today.

I thought Spencer White showed highlights which will become more exciting next season - not ready for this year .
Liked the look of Dunnell especially in the 2nd half when things got tight.
Ross was a level above at the stoppages.
Ledger started like a house on fire but his disposal kills him and may explain why other leap frog him.
Tought Minchington showed a bit early but ran out of legs.
Staley, Lever, Pierce Big skinny kids which means need time before critical decisions.
Simpkin solid in defence
Saad disappointing
Interesting that the guys with experience came to the fore front in the last qtr when tough and hard game
